Course Content

• Fundamentals of Remote Sensing for Forestry
• Forest Inventory and Monitoring using Remote Sensing
• LiDAR and its Applications in Forest Biomass Estimation
• Image Classification Techniques for Forest Mapping (including supervised and unsupervised classification)
• Advanced Spectral Indices for Forest Productivity Assessment (NDVI, EVI, etc.)
• Object-Based Image Analysis (OBIA) in Forest Applications
• Time Series Analysis of Satellite Imagery for Forest Change Detection
• Remote Sensing Data Integration and GIS Applications for Forestry
• Uncertainty and Error Analysis in Remote Sensing of Forests
• Case Studies in Remote Sensing for Forest Productivity Monitoring and Management

Career Role Description
Remote Sensing Analyst (Forestry) Analyze satellite imagery and LiDAR data to assess forest health, growth, and biomass. A crucial role in sustainable forest management.
GIS Specialist (Forest Resources) Develop and manage geospatial databases, integrating remote sensing data for forest resource monitoring and planning. High demand in conservation and forestry.
Environmental Consultant (Remote Sensing) Utilize remote sensing techniques to advise clients on environmental impact assessments and sustainable land management strategies, focusing on forest ecosystems. Strong analytical and communication skills needed.
Forestry Researcher (Remote Sensing Applications) Conduct research using advanced remote sensing techniques to improve forest management practices and understand the impacts of climate change. A high-growth area in academic and research institutions.
